The League bills it self being an ultra exclusive solution with “no voyeurs, no randoms, no games, no fakes, no sound with no pity.” It vets prospective users through their Facebook and Linkedin records to verify work and education claims, and after that point registrants must certanly be furthermore vetted with a individual before they’ve been accepted to the solution.
“We try to find singles with drive and aspiration. It is called by us an application for aspiring energy partners,” The League founder and CEO Amanda Bradford told ABC13. “We consider where some body decided to go to college, what jobs they will have had so we actually glance at that few having an intent to really maintain a relationship.”
Bradford stated ineffective, aggravating and general “pretty terrible” experiences on other dating apps encouraged her to launch The League – and this woman is a walking testimonial for the solution. Bradford stated she actually is currently in a relationship with someone she came across through The League, which was running on some other cities that are major 2014.
For many nevertheless to locate Mr. or Ms. Right, The League formally established in Houston on June 27, 2017. Around 300 regarding the a lot more than 7,300 Houston-area applicants had been invited to Rosemont, a rooftop club in Montrose, prior to the launch for the flavor associated with software’s founding course.

And Ogbam is not alone in their perception that is initial of League – the solution has arrived under fire to be exclusionary and elitist predicated on its vetting methods, claims that Bradford state are misconstrued.
“we are perhaps not people that are necessarily excluding our company is maintaining the city tiny to carry people in gradually to help keep the city different,” she stated. “we have been being conscientious with your development model and select those who should be users that are good embody the rise different types of the city.”
But exactly what about those people who are seeking to get in to the exclusive club plus don’t feel just like they’ve the prerequisite application? Bradford said the answer to admission is based on just how users build their pages.
“You are building an advertising campaign yourself,” she explained. “Think strategically concerning the photos you like. Ensure that you’ve actually completed your profile, for the reason that it really helps make the instance that you are there for an objective.”
“Put plenty of humor and character inside it. Place your cards up for grabs,” she recommended. “Show down who you really are.”
